PHP字符串操作入门教程
PHP字符串操作入门教程 无论哪种语言,字符串操作都是一个重要的基础,往往是简单而重要。正像人说话一样,一般有形体(图形界面),有语言(print 字符串?),显然字符串能解释更多的东西。PHP提供了大量的字符串操作函数,功能强大,使用也比较简单,详细请参看 http://cn2.php.net/manual/zh/ref.strings.php . 以下将简单的讲述它的功能和特性。 弱类型 PHP是弱类型语言,所以其它类型的数据一般可以直接应用于字符串操作函数里,而自动转换成字符串类型......
函数:sprintf()将字符串格式化输出
函数:sprintf() 字符串处理函数库 sprintf 将字符串格式化。 语法: string sprintf(string format, mixed [args]...); 返回值: 字符串 函数种类: 资料处理 内容说明 本函数用来将字符串格式化......
PHP数学函数
1、绝对值函数 ·mixed abs(number) 2、取得arc cosine 值 ·float acos(float arg) 3、取得arc ine 值 ·float asin(float arg) 4、取得arc tangent值 ·float atan(float arg) 5、取得2个变量的arc tangent值 ·float atan2(float x,float y) 6、字符串数字进制转换 string base_convert(string number,int 原始进制, int要转换的进制) 进制2-36 7、进制转换 int bindec(string):10转2进制,最大范围是31个bit 或2147483647 string decbin(int)2转10进制 string dechex(int)10转16 int hexdec(string)16转10 string ......
PHP 的字符集编码问题
几乎每个刚开始用 PHP 和 mySQL 开发 Web 应用的人,都受到过编码问题的困扰。要么页面原始汉字和从数据库里取出的汉字全是乱码;要么原始汉字和数据库汉字,一个显示正常了,另一个就变成乱码了。很烦很气人! 问题需要一步一步的解决。在实际操作以下方法之前,需要配置 Web 服务器,使其与 PHP 集成,最终可以调试 PHP 程序。我们以常见的 GB2312 和 UTF-8 字符集为例来测试和说明。浏览器是 IE7.0。 一,页面原始汉字乱码的解决 ......
Cannot modify header information - headers already sent by错误解决办法
在后台管理,用header("location:");做返回时,总是不能正常返回, Warning: Cannot modify header information - headers already sent by.... 这类语句,baidu了一下,才知道是setcookie在捣乱,以下是在网上找的一些资料: 方法一: 在PHP里Cookie的使用是有一些限制的。 1、使用setcookie必须在<html>标签之前 2、使用setcookie之前,不可以使用echo输入内容 3、直到网页被加载完后,cookie才会出现 4、setcookie必须放到任何资料输出浏览器前,才送出 ..... 由于上面的限制......
使用php读取pdf文档的方式
好久不在网上见你,真有点说不出来的感觉,没有hunte的phpuser.com什么也不是. 转了你站上的两篇文章, 特翻了一篇了以示致歉. ---------------------------------------------------- 原作者:Perugini Luca (www.phpbuilder.com) 译者:znsoft (http://www.phpease.com) --------------------------------------------------- 转载请保留以上信息,否则请不要转载! PHP捆绑PDFLIB库也许是最好的web出版平台了。一对典型的用法: 需求小册子 电子商务发货单 通过这个指南,你可以学会怎样使用php4中的PDF扩展来创建PDF文档......
php 正则表达式(详细)
平时做网站经常要用正则表达式,下面是一些讲解和例子,仅供大家参考和修改使用: "^d $" //非负整数(正整数 0) "^[0-9]*[1-9][0-9]*$" //正整数 "^((-d )|(0 ))$" //非正整数(负整数 0) "^-[0-9]*[1-9][0-9]*$" //负整数 "^-?d $" //整数 "^d (.d )?$" //非负浮点数(正浮点数 0) "^(([0-9] .[0-9]*[1-9][0-9]*)|([0-9]*[1-9][0-9]*.[0-9] )|([0-9]*[1-9][0-9]*))$" //正浮点数 "^((-d (.d )?)|(0 (.0 )?))$" //非正浮点数(负浮点数 ......
一个php发送邮件类|实例|方法
<?php class smtp { var $smtp_port; var $time_out; var $host_name; var $log_file; var $relay_host; var $debug; var $auth; var $user; var $pass; var $sock; function smtp($relay_host = "", $smtp_port = 25,$auth = false,$user,$pass) { $this->debug = true; $this->smtp_port = $smtp_port; $this->relay_host = $relay_host; $this->time_out = 30; $this->auth = $auth; $this->user = $user; $this->pass = $pass; $this->host_name = "localhost"; $this->log_file =""; $this->sock = FALSE; } func......
php编程时如何将Excel中数据导出到MySQL数据库
savetomysql.php源代码如下: <?php $dbname=$_POST[dbname]; $tbname=$_POST[tbname]; mysql_connect("localhost","root","root"); mysql_query("set names gb2312"); mysql_query("drop database ".$dbname."if exists"); mysql_query("create database ".$dbname.""); mysql_query("use ".$dbname.""); mysql_query("drop table ".$tbname."if exists"); mysql_query("CREATE TABLE ".$tbname."( `id` INT( 8 ) NOT NULL AUTO_INCREMENT PRIMARY KEY , `book......
php实现用下载软件下载
<?php $url = "http://t.com/1.doc"; $xl = 'thunder://'.base64_encode('AA'.$url.'ZZ').'/'; //$kuai ='Flashget://'.base64_encode('AA'.$url.'ZZ').'/'; $kuai ="Flashget://".base64_encode("[FLASHGET]".$url."[FLASHGET]")."&aiyh"; $qq="qqdl://".base64_encode($url); ?> <br/> 迅雷下载 &......
- Page:83/145 1448 Blogs
周日 | 周一 | 周二 | 周三 | 周四 | 周五 | 周六 |
文章分类
- 默认(748)
- 日志(47)
- 感悟(15)
- testIT(4)
- PHP_XML(5)
- PHP(78)
- 明星(1)
- 笑话(31)
- 毕业论文(2)
- 生活(60)
- HTML(11)
- CSS(6)
- 考研(3)
- JS(21)
- 简历(6)
- svn(3)
- 音乐(1)
- 学习(7)
- jQuery(9)
- 英语口语(9)
- 书籍(2)
- magento(258)
- apache(12)
- 创意(4)
- 设计(4)
- 休闲(1)
- IT咨询(11)
- 工作(23)
- ubuntu(21)
- bysoft(1)
- zend(1)
- web(2)
- software(1)
- sql(5)
- 娱乐(5)
- photoshop(3)
- zend framework(2)
- nginx(3)
- 小说(1)
- 名言(1)
- 牛人(1)
- Mysql(6)
- vim(2)
- wordpress(8)
- drupal(1)